Robert "Bob" Wilden, Sr., 91, (formerly of Hastings, NE) died Thursday, September 28, 2017 in Topeka, KS following a brief illness. Bob was born in January of 1926 in Owosso, MI to Albert and Lillian Wilden.
He was preceded in death by his sister Catherine and his beloved wife Norma. Bob is survived by 7 children: Suzanne Nadeau, Topeka, KS; Bob Wilden, Jr., Lee Summit, MO; Dennis Wilden, Omaha, NE; Christine Lewis, Sarasota, FL; Lillian Hollingsed, Phoenix, AZ; Patricia Wilden, Topeka, KS and Joseph Wilden also of Topeka, KS. He is also survived by 17 grandchildren, 34 great-grandchildren and 4 great-great-grandchildren.
Bob met Norma while he was in the Army, stationed at Hastings, NE. They were married for 62 years. For most of his life Bob worked as an optician and an optical dispenser. He loved working with the public; he could make a new friend in an instant. He was an avid card player and irrepressible dancer who loved great music, a good joke and a cold beer.
In recent years Bob was a resident of Lexington Park in Topeka. The family expresses heartfelt thanks to the excellent staff at Lexington and also to the staff of Great Lakes Caring Hospice for their love and support for Bob and his family.
